Support The App Moto Jam and Strange Days this weekend!
We are proud to be support Strange Days and App Moto Jam once again.
One lucky person will be the proud new owner of this 1972 Harley Davidson Sportster next weekend, and it could be you! Tickets for a chance to win this beautiful "Then Came Bronson" clone bike will be on sale for $10 apiece or 3 for $25 at Strange Days 9, until they conclude with the ticket drawing around 7:00 PM on Saturday July 13th; don't miss out!
Bonus - Moto Jam will hosting Flat Track races Friday night July 12. This outlaw hooligan series is fun for the first time rider to the pros, don't miss the action on Oakland Valley Speedway's 1/4 mile dirt oval!

To participate in Moto Jam series you can sign up at registration booth Friday July 12. Registration is 3-5pm - practice is 5-6pm - racing is 6-9pm. Awards to follow. Please visit Moto Jam for more racing details www.appmotojam.com.

The Bonneville Speed Week 2018 documentary filmed by Mikey Arnold reveals Team Lowbrow's determination for fixing issues on the fly to accomplish goals set by each racer. The one hour film embodies friendship, integrity, brotherhood, and showcases the highs and lows that come with the sport of racing. Kudos to Tyler & Kyle Malinky, Andy Cox, and Alp Sungurtekin for achieving new land speed records and for never giving up. January 27,2018 - Moto Jam Winter Race - Monticello, NY
"Come join the fun on January 27 as Appalachian Moto Jam brings motorcycles to the slippery slopes of Holiday Ski Mountain. Saturday, January 27 we will be hosting Moto Snow Drag Races and a Baja Snow Climb Under the lights. Holiday Ski resort will be open all day/night with a warm lodge, food, bar, and restrooms. Dress warm and see you this winter!!"-@appmotojam

Moto Jam Hillclimb / Oct. 28, 2017
The Moto Jam Hillclimb is brought to you by Kenny Buongiorno and the merry team at Appalachian Moto Jam. Expect an action packed day with vintage motorcycle races, swap meet, hill climb and costume party on October 28th. It's located at the Gotham Mountain MX at 99 Holiday Mtn Road in Monticello NY. Don't forget to get a costume ladies and gentlemen. $100 prize for the best costume for public. Best rider costume will get a comp registration. Prizes will be giving during awards at 5 pm. Save the date: Oct 8 - Appalachian Moto Jam
Motorcycle Dirt Track Racing, NY, Oct 8 // Appalachian Moto Jam
Appalachian Moto Jam is Premier motorcycle races, vendors, awards, music and camping in the gorgeous mountians of Cuddebackville, NY. October 8, Oakland Valley Speedway. 3 bikes make a class // $15 general admission // vendors & camping $20 // Racers $40 per class
- 8am gates open
- 9-11am registration
- 11am riders meeting then practice
- 12pm lets get racing
- 7pm awards
- 8pm Live bluegrass music by HawkOwls at bonfire
